Pawan Kalyan is a huge star and there is no denying that fact. In many of his interviews, he has clearly revealed that he is only doing films to run his political party, Janasena. As a part of it, he has signed multiple films but they are taking forever to get wrapped up and find a release date in the first place.

When the producers of some of the Pawan Kalyan films thought that they could make big money by selling the rights of these films much in advance, the distributors in AP and Telangana gave them a shock. The distributors are now demanding the release dates for few of these films to invest in them. But the sad part is that even the producers do not have the release dates.

Going into details, Pawan is doing close to five films now and only the movie with Sai Dharam Tej has been locked for July28th release and rest of the big films have not yet locked the dates. Also, once 2024 starts, Pawan will get busy with elections in AP and he will find it tough to wrap up these films on time. Seeing all this, the distributors are not ready to shell out big bucks in advance and wait in the wings for the film to get released.

Also, Pawan Kalyan is such a person who is not sure when he can turn up to the shoots and when he can even call off a project. He has Hari Hara Veera Mallu with Krish which has been in the making for over two years now. Then there is OG with Sahoo fame Sujeeth. Pawan is now shooting for Ustad Bhagath Singh with Harish Shankar and there is one more film in the pipeline which will be announced soon.

So when will Pawan Kalyan finish these films in the first place is the major doubt raised by the distributors and they are shying away to buy the rights of these films.
